RTB definition

RTB means the preserved right to buy as set out in sections 171A to 171H of the Housing Act 1985 the right to acquire scheme as set out in Section 16 of the Housing Act 1996 or any right pursuant to the Leasehold Reform Act 1967 or the Leasehold Reform Housing and Urban Development Act 1993 or any other similar right to buy conferred by statute including any voluntary scheme which may be operated by the Transferee which is similar to the Right to Buy

RTB means that a Project has obtained all necessary permits and licenses, as defined in Annex B, to proceed with its construction and operation.
RTB means the Rural Telephone Bank, a body corporate and instrumentality of the United States established pursuant to 7 U.S.C. 941.

RTB means the Residential Tenancies Board under Section 127 of the Act of 2004.
